
body{font-family:verdana;font-size:11px;color:#000066;background-color : #001F77;margin:0px;background-position : top left;margin-left:0 ;margin-top:0;}
body{fontfamily:verdana;fontsize:11px;}

td, input, select, textarea {font-family:verdana; font-size:11px; color:#000066;}
input{ font-size:9.5px; }
hr{color:#666666;}

h1 {color: #000066;font-size: 14pt;font-weight: bold;font-style: normal;}

/* CONTENT AREA */
#content{top:198px; left:0px; width:164px; height:207px; clip:rect(0px 164px 207px 0px); overflow:hidden; z-index:0;}
#contentnav{top:153px; left:260px;}
#contenttext{width:144px; height:207px;}
#contentimages{top:0px; left:397px; width:138px; height:207px;}

a { color:red; font-family: arial, verdana, serif; font-weight: bold; font-size: 8pt; text-decoration: none; }
a:visited { color:#CC0000;}
a:hover { color:#FF6633;}
a:active { color:#FF6633;}



a.white { color:#ffffff; font-family: arial, verdana, serif; font-weight: bold; font-size: 9pt; text-decoration: none; letter-spacing:0px;}
a:visited.white { color:#ffffff;}
a:hover.white { color:red;}
a:active.white { color:red;}

a.bullets {
	color:#ffffff;font-family: arial, verdana, serif;font-weight: bold;font-size: 9pt;text-decoration: none;}
a:visited.bullets { color:#ffffff;}
a:hover.bullets { color:red;}
a:active.bullets { color:red;}

a.red {color:#CC0000; font-family: arial, verdana, serif; font-weight: bold; font-size: 9pt; text-decoration: none; letter-spacing : 0px; vertical-align : middle; }
a:visited.red {color:#0D2D85;}
a:hover.red {color:red;}
a:active.red {color:red;}

a.title {color:#000066; font-family: arial, verdana, serif; font-weight: bold; font-size: 10pt; text-decoration: none;	letter-spacing : 0px; vertical-align : middle; }
a:visited.title{color:#0D2D85;}
a:hover.title {color:red;}
a:active.title {color:red;}

.title { color:#000066; font-size:10pt; font-family: arial;  font-weight: bold; margin-left:15px;}
.title2 { color:#000066; font-size:9pt; font-family: arial; font-weight: bold;}
.title3 { color:#000066; font-size:10pt; font-family: arial; font-weight: normal;}

.white { color:white; font-family: arial, verdana, serif; font-weight: normal; font-size: 8pt; line-height: normal; letter-spacing: 1px;}
.white { fontfamily: arial, verdana, serif; fontweight: normal; fontsize: 8pt; lineheight: normal;  }
.text { color:#000066; font-family: arial, verdana, serif; font-weight: normal; font-size: 9pt; line-height: normal;  }
.text { fontfamily: arial, verdana, serif; fontweight: normal; fontsize: 9pt; lineheight: normal;  }

font.newsdate			{font-family: Verdana, Arial; font-size: 10pt; color: black;}
font.newshead			{font-family: Verdana, Arial; font-size: 11pt; color: red; font-weight: bold;}
font.newstext			{font-family: Verdana, Arial; font-size: 10pt; color: #003366;}

a:link.newslink			{font-family: Verdana, Arial; font-size: 10pt; color: #003366; font-weight: bold; text-decoration: none;}
a:active.newslink		{color: #225588; font-family: Verdana, Arial; font-size: 10pt; font-weight: bold; text-decoration: none;}
a:visited.newslink		{color: #660000; font-family: Verdana, Arial; font-size: 10pt; font-weight: bold; text-decoration: none;}
a:hover.newslink		{color: #333366; font-family: Verdana, Arial; font-size: 10pt; font-weight: bold; color: #225588; text-decoration: underline;}

.tourhead { color:red; font-size:12pt; font-family: arial, verdana, serif; font-weight: bold; line-height: normal; }
.tourhead { fontsize:12pt; fontfamily: arial, verdana, serif; fontweight: bold;  }

.tourbig { color:#003366; font-family:  arial, verdana, serif; font-weight: bold; font-size: 10pt; line-height: normal;  }
.tourbig{ fontfamily: arial, verdana, serif; fontweight: normal; fontsize: 10pt; lineheight: normal;  }

.tour { color:#003366; font-family: verdana, arial, serif; font-weight: normal; font-size: 8pt; line-height: normal;  }
.tour{ fontfamily: arial, verdana, serif; fontweight: normal; fontsize: 9pt; lineheight: normal;  }

.toursm { color:#003366; font-family: verdana, arial, serif; font-weight: normal; font-size: 7pt; line-height: normal;  }
.toursm { fontfamily: verdana, arial, serif; fontweight: normal; fontsize: 8pt; }
p { margin-bottom : 3pt; margin-top : 1pt; margin-left : 5pt;margin-right : 7pt;}


.class1 {background-color: #D5E3F7;background-image:none;border-color:#5686D8;border-style:solid;border-top-width:1px;border-right-width:1px;border-left-width:1px;border-bottom-width:1px;}

.class1 td {background-color: #D5E3F7;background-image:none;border-color: #5686D8;border-style:solid;border-top-width:1;border-right-width:1;border-left-width:1;border-bottom-width:1;padding-top:4px;padding-right:4px;padding-left:4px;padding-bottom:4px;margin-top:2px;margin-bottom:2px;margin-right:2px;margin-left:2px;}
.class2 {
	background-color: #D5E3F7;
	background-image:none;
	border-color: #5686D8;
	border-style:solid;
	border-top-width:1px;
	border-right-width:1px;
	border-left-width:1px;
	border-bottom-width:1px;
}
.class2 td {
	background-color: #D5E3F7;
	background-image:none;
	border-color: #5686D8;
	border-style:solid;
	border-top-width:1px;
	border-right-width:1px;
	border-left-width:1px;
	border-bottom-width:1px;
	padding-top:4px;
	padding-right:4px;
	padding-left:4px;
	padding-bottom:4px;
	margin-top:2px;
	margin-bottom:2px;
	margin-right:2px;
	margin-left:2px;
}
.class1 td.tourhead {
	background-color: #D5E3F7;
	background-image:none;
	border-color: #5686D8;
	border-style:solid;
	border-top-width:1px;
	border-right-width:1px;
	border-left-width:1px;
	border-bottom-width:1px;
	padding-top:3px;
	padding-right:3px;
	padding-left:3px;
	padding-bottom:3px;
	margin-top:2px;
	margin-bottom:2px;
	margin-right:2px;
	margin-left:2px;
}
.class1 tr.tourhead {
	background-color: #D5E3F7;
	background-image:none;
	border-color: #5686D8;
	border-style:solid;
	border-top-width:1px;
	border-right-width:1px;
	border-left-width:1px;
	border-bottom-width:1;
	padding-top:3px;
	padding-right:3px;
	padding-left:3px;
	padding-bottom:3px;
	margin-top:2px;
	margin-bottom:2px;
	margin-right:2px;
	margin-left:2px;
}

.ttable {background: #7F7BA0;}
.thead {background: #B7B2D8;}
.tcells1 {background: #EEE1DB;}
.tcells2 {background: #F5E6D3;}




/* FORUM */


//.subject {font-size: 10pt;font-family: arial;font-weight: bold;background-color:#CCCCFF; }

.post {font-size: 12pt;font-weight: normal;font-family: arial;}

h1.path a {font-weight:bold; font-size:12px; color:#9999CC; font-family: arial; text-decoration:none;}
  .path a:visited {color:#9999CC;}
  .path a:active {color:black;}
  .path a:hover {color:black;}

.header {color: white; background-color: #CC0000; font-family: Verdana;font-weight: bold; font-size: 10px;}
.header2 {background-color: #E6E6FF;font-family: Verdana;font-weight: bold;font-size: 11px;}

.category { background-color: #E6E6FF; font-family: arial; font-size: 10pt; }
.nav { color:white;font-family: arial; font-weight: bold; font-size: 10pt; }
.smalltxt { color:red;font-size: 9pt; font-family: arial;}
.mediumtxt { font-size: 10pt; font-family: arial; font-weight: normal; color: black;  }
.navtd { font-size: 11px; font-family: arial; color: white; background-color: #CC0000; text-decoration: none; }
.multi { color:white;font-family: verdana; font-size: 11px; }

textarea, select, input, object { font-family: Verdana, arial, helvetica, sans-serif; font-size: 12px;  font-weight: normal;  background-color: #E6E6FF;  color: black;  }

.tablerow { background-color:white; font-family: arial; color: black; font-size: 10pt; }
.altbg2 { background-color:#E6E6FF; font-family: arial; color: black; font-size: 10pt; } 
.altbg1  { background-color:#CCCCFF; font-family: arial; color: black; font-size: 10pt; }
.top_head { background-color:#E6E6FF; }
.bordercolor { background-color:white; }




.tsubmit {background: #EEEEEE;}

/*MenuSUB*/

.submenu {clear:both;}
.submenulnk {border:1px solid gray; margin:15px;}

.sublist {width:90%; margin-left: 10px; margin-bottom: 0px; font-weight: normal; font-size: 8pt; border-bottom:1px solid gray; margin:8px; padding-bottom:4px; padding-top:10px;}

.sublist a {display: block; width: 150px; float:left; }
.sublistDescr {display: block; float:left;}

.statusprivilege td {font-weight: normal; }
.statusprivilege td a {padding-left: 13px; background-image : url(/imagemap/heart.gif); 	background-repeat : no-repeat;}
.chBox {border:0px solid white;}

/*Оформление текста*/

.BigLetter     {color:#1BCBFF; font-weight:bold; font-size:14pt;}
.CopyRight      {font-size:10px;color:gray;}


/*Формы*/
form 	                {margin:0; padding:0;}
select, input, textarea	{border:1px solid #AA0000;}

.fShort 	{width:70px;}
.fMidi		{width:200px;}
.fLong  	{width:400px;}
.fSubmit	{width:200px;text-transform:uppercase;}

textarea.fLong {height:100px;width:100%;}


/*Навигация*/
.Nav	    {border:1px solid #c5c5c5; padding:3px;margin:0px; text-align:center; width:80%; background-color:#ddd;}
.NavRef	    {padding:0px;margin:0px; text-align:center; width:300px;}
.NavPage    {}
.NavPageNum {font-weight:bold;} 
.NavBegin   {width:25%;float:left;}
.NavEnd	    {width:25%;float:left;}
.NavNext    {width:25%;float:left;}
.NavPrev    {width:25%;float:left;}

.content {font-weight: normal; font-size: 8pt;}



